The co-founder of Opower Alex Laskey describes the need to design a new grid system, and the need for policies to determine the rules and regulation of the market for innovated grid, as well as the "need to make energy efficiency and power grid plans simple enough for consumers to understand them.[10] Since the nature of energy generated from renewable resources such as wind and solar power do not produce the amount needed to meet peak demand times, the NREL suggests several energy storage and regulation options that could increase the flexibility of renewable energy sources to meet the country's needs efficiently. Resolutions generally result from informal utility requests called Advice Letters, which are submitted by utilities to request rate and tariff adjustments.
